Heather Dewey-Hagborg

Heather Dewey-Hagborg's work in progress, "Stranger Visions," is a series of portrait sculptures.  Heather has been collecting "traces" of genetic material left behind by strangers in public places.  The portraits are created from her analysis of the materials DNA.
